Ferris State Women's Golf Captures Team Championship In First Spring Action

Big Rapids, Mich. - The Ferris State University women's golf team started its spring season off with a bang as the Bulldogs took first place at the BrownGolf Intercollegiate Championships on Friday (March 11) at Whispering Pines in North Carolina.

In FSU's first competition of the spring, the Bulldogs carded a two-round 640 team score to post a 14-hole win over runner-up Gannon in the nine-team field.

The Bulldogs' Alayna Eldred earned medalist honors on the par 72 course measuring 5,803 yards, shooting a 151 score for the 36 holes of action, including a round two 77 mark.

Eldred tied for first overall with teammate Danielle Staskowski, who also shot 151 for the two rounds and came in second overall, but Eldred won a playoff for medalist honors.

The Bulldogs' Abby Grevel finished tied for 15th (168) with Lauren Kempf tied for 22nd (170) and Hope Thebo placed tied for 30th (173).

FSU's Juanita De La Cruz competed as an individual and finished tied for 15th as well in the field with a 168 two-round score.

The event was shorted back to a single day and the 36 holes were contested in two rounds on Friday due to expected weather later this weekend.

The Bulldogs will compete in the Findlay Spring Invitational slated for March 21-22 in Lexington, Ky.
